Its a joke.I followed the instructions on Lineage's website for this device, bought it from walmart outright and activated it with Total by Verizon. Only issue I had was receiving text messages until I popped the sim card out, restarted the phone and then reinserted the tray, then a day's worth of texts came flooding in and I haven't had a single issue since.

Ok, I read either on another LOS forum here or on reddit but someone mentioned a fix was to reboot with a different sim card and it apparently repaired the connectivity issue (not sure if it was permanent) . So without an additional sim card, I just removed my sim card and rebooted my phone. When it restarted it was connected to wifi. I then put the simcard tray back and all of the missed sms messages came flooding through.
